Yanal wrote:
> I am not sure if i needed to do something to the CD inorder for it to  
> become bootable, I just downloaded the iso image (shrike-i386-disc1.iso) 
> and burned it to the CD.

Check your BIOS settings to make sure that it's set to try booting off 
the CD before the hard drive.  Look for "boot order" or something of the 
sort.
